Preview: State vs Wake

Today will be an old fashioned rubber match between the Deacons and the Wolfpack. Both teams won their respective home contests. Wake took the first game in Winston Salem, winning by 3 points after holding a large lead over the Pack before they rallied to bring it within a possesion. In Raleigh it was another high scoring affair in which the Pack won by 11, bolstered by Barber’s 38 points. NC State must play their game and simply score more than the Deacons, I know on the surface this is obvious, the team with more points wins, but State has got to score a lot of points because their defense has been so terrible. On the season they are letting up 73.9 points per game.

Both teams are who they are at this point, both teams are bad defensively but have the capability of scoring on offense. That is why today’s game should be an entertaining one, a high scoring match that will most likely come down to the last 4 minutes. I believe that State will get the victory today. The Pack have much more upside and are more equipped to have a break out game offensively. The main thing for NC State is to try and make things difficult for Devin Thomas and Bryant Crawford. Then contain X-Factor Codi Miller-McIntyre, who has been a thorn in State’s side his whole career. In his last game in Raleigh the senior scored 24 points. If he gets close to that mark today NC State will be in trouble.

If State can take care of the basketball and play with great energy their is no reason why they should lose to Wake Forest. Coach Mark Gottfried has proven over time that he can get his team ready for Tournament basketball! In each of his seasons at the helm his teams have played some of their best basketball at the end of the season. Although he may have a less bullets in the clip than recent years, he will undoubtedly have his group playing hard. Game time is slated for 12PM, and can be seen locally on WRAL, as well as on ESPN2. If State can beat Wake Forest today, they will face Duke on Wednesday at 2:30.
